Emre Kubat practices in Ankara, Turkey. Mr. Kubat is rated as an Experienced expert by MediFind in the treatment of Thoracic Aortic Aneurysm. His top areas of expertise are Varicose Veins, Buerger Disease, Thromboangiitis Obliterans, Heart Bypass Surgery, and Thrombectomy.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 42 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years. In particular, he has co-authored 5 articles in the study of Thoracic Aortic Aneurysm.
